EPS/TSDCR Regenerative DC Load System 60kW-2,6MW

EPS/TSDCR Regenerative DC Load System 60kW-2,6MW Source - Sink - Battery Charger/Tester/Simulator - Inverter - up to 2.6MW from EPS Stromversorgung

The EPS/TSDCR calibrated test systems from EPS Power Supply are suitable for development-related tests, such as tests of electric drives and fuel cells and their corresponding components, batteries (discharging/charging) and switches. The power ratings go up to 650kW (in parallel connection) in a voltage range from 5 to 1500V and a current range up to 1200A.

The special feature of these systems is that the electrical energy absorbed in generator mode is fed back into the power supply grid with high efficiency. External loads (resistors) are therefore superfluous and electrical energy that would otherwise be "wasted" can be fed back profitably. This regenerative capability is a decisive factor in most test applications, as unusually high power levels are used here.

To increase performance, either parallel connection (up to 4800A/2.6MW) or a multi-channel system (up to 9600A) is possible. In contrast to conventional DC sources, the multi-channel system has two or four independently usable output channels and can operate both as a source and as a sink.

All systems have an electrically isolated output and a TFT touch panel for entering or displaying values and alarms. They can also be controlled via CAN, MODbus TCP (Ethernet), VNC and optionally via HighSpeed/Analog, HighSpeed CAN, Profibus, Profinet and Ethercat. Programming languages are optional: LabView, MatlabSimulink and SCPI.

The system can be freely programmed and has specific algorithms that enable a wide range of tests such as battery tests, testing of fuel cells and solar systems (inverter option), DC electric motors, supercapacitors and power factor correction.

Extensive protective measures, such as an integrated event memory and safety control (level "d") as standard, round off the concept. The system can be "upgraded" to customer specifications, e.g. with insulation monitoring, protective diode for safe sink operation, DC contactors for disconnection under load, power distributor, energy meter or water cooling (IP54, incl. at 300/600kW).
The systems are CE-certified and can optionally be adapted to UL.

Further options on request, as well as higher voltages and currents.

Energy efficiency: New technology, high efficiency regenerative power supply with over 93%
